Can The Cheapest Diesel Option Actually Cost More?

Take the example of a truck that has to load up with 150 gallons. If one fueling station is charging $3.70 per gallon whereas the other one is charging $3.85, the savings of $22.50 from the first option looks very significant. 

However, it would matter only if the first station can be reached without causing any expenses in the rest of the journey. For instance, if the truck has to travel an additional distance to reach the first fueling station, it will burn more fuel in covering that distance, and time will be lost going around and coming back on the way.

Why Are Truck Stops Becoming Part Of The Fuel Data Picture?

Fueling is rarely the only reason a commercial driver enters a truck stop. Depending on the trip and timing, the same stop may need to provide parking, food, restrooms, showers, DEF, maintenance, or other services. When those details are available alongside fuel information, the stop becomes part of a larger operational decision.

This becomes particularly useful on long-haul routes where drivers have limited opportunities to stop without affecting the rest of the schedule. If a driver needs fuel and is approaching the point where a rest break will also be necessary, a truck stop that can satisfy both requirements may be more valuable than a cheaper station that addresses only the fuel requirement.

In that context, navigation is helping consolidate decisions that would otherwise be made separately. Fuel, parking, and services become connected parts of the same stop rather than unrelated searches performed at different points during the trip.

How Does Fuel-Price Data Affect Fleet Operations?

The importance of the decisions made in the above situations is made all the more obvious on the fleet level since the slight difference can make a large impact when it is made over thousands of miles. According to the American Transportation Research Institute, the operating cost per mile of a truck came in at $2.336 in 2025, which was the highest in the annual study ever conducted by them.

This does not imply that the fleets just ask their drivers to use stations with the lowest price for diesel fuel. The cheapest gallon is not necessarily the cheapest decision if obtaining it introduces additional mileage or disrupts the route.

This is where connected navigation can provide useful support. Instead of leaving fuel decisions entirely to habit or last-minute availability, fleets and drivers can use route-based information to make those decisions earlier and with more context.

Why Does Real-Time Fuel Information Matter Before The Tank Is Low?

The timing factor makes the fuel price data useful. A person whose car is running on low gas has limited options and will have to rely more on convenience rather than the fuel cost or efficiency of the route. In the case of a driver who can see several appropriate gas stations ahead, he has the time to select from them.
